Problem
Conventional methods for calculating the relative position between two vehicles based on navigation satellite signals have significant calculation errors, ranging from several meters to scores of meters, which are not sufficient for precise applications.
Innovation Solution
A relative inter-vehicle position calculation apparatus that determines the carrier wave phase of radio waves from multiple navigation satellites and calculates the relative position based on the difference between the carrier wave phases received by two vehicles, employing Carrier-Phase DGPS positioning to achieve precision up to one meter or less.

An on-board communication equipment on each of two vehicles receives a radio wave from two or more GPS satellites, and determines a carrier wave phase of the received radio wave. Then, the on-board communication equipment on one vehicle receives, from the other vehicle, information on the carrier wave phase observed in the other vehicle. Further, the on-board communication equipment calculates a relative position of a self vehicle relative to the other vehicle by a Carrier-Phase DGPS positioning based on a difference between two carrier wave phases (e.g., single difference, double difference or the like), that is, one from the self vehicle and one from the other vehicle, both having the same observation time, from among the available carrier wave phases.
